UC Mechanical Engineering This is the official page on the Department of Mechanical Engineering at the University of Canterbury Modern mechanical engineering is interesting and diverse.

The Department of Mechanical Engineering is involved in teaching the Mechanical and Mechatronics Engineering degree programs. We have excellent facilities for both teaching and research in all three of these disciplines, and staff engaged in a wide range of research activities. It covers all manner of energy utilization with minimal pollution of the environment. It covers transport, machinery and

manufacture and the efficient use of mechanisms without excessive vibrations and stresses. It covers materials and measurement and the research, economic, social and management dimensions that support its activity. All these aspects are coordinated through design and information technology. The result is an attractive diversity of the profession and a wide demand for its graduates. Although the University is still in the middle of the term break, the Mechanical Engineering department was bustling last week as we welcomed young engineers aged 9–13 to our facilities for KidsFest 2026!

Across three hands-on days, participants built and tested earthquake-resistant towers on a shake table, designed low-drag vehicles for wind-tunnel testing, and constructed mechanical, string-controlled prosthetic hands using 3D-printed parts. They also toured the Mechanical Engineering facilities and learned more about the many possibilities within engineering.

Thank you to everyone involved in delivering the sessions, and to all the enthusiastic young engineers who helped make KidsFest 2026 such a fun and memorable event!

We’re now recruiting Mechanical Engineering Final Year Project topics.

Mechanical Engineering Final Year Projects bring together design, modelling, analysis, and validation to explore complex engineering problems with real unknowns, rather than routine solutions.

Each year, multiple student teams work in parallel on industry- and research-informed challenges, taking projects through to a proof-of-principle or working prototype stage and presenting their outcomes as part of a structured programme.

Strong projects offer sufficient scope for a small student team to take ownership of different work streams and involve an engaged sponsor who can provide regular guidance and an external perspective.

What does a Final Year Project look like when designs leave the screen and start working?

In this short clip, our Mechanical Engineering students reflect on their Final Year Project experience — from developing a concept to seeing a seedling lifter tested in real-world conditions.

Final Year Projects allow students to take engineering ideas beyond design and into proof-of-concept testing, while offering industry partners the opportunity to explore early-stage engineering ideas before committing to full-scale solutions.

We want to thank Forest Growers Research Ltd (FGR) for partnering with our students on this project.

Congratulations to Morgan Stuthridge for completing his Master of Engineering with a thesis titled “Benchmarks for Aerodynamic Modelling of Hypersonic Vehicles.”

Supervised by Professor John Cater and Stephen Campbell, Morgan’s research develops and validates computational fluid dynamics (CFD) methods for modelling hypersonic vehicle aerodynamics. By benchmarking simulation accuracy against experimental data, his work enhances predictions of pressure, heat transfer, and shock interactions—supporting future hypersonic aerospace and defence applications in Aotearoa New Zealand.

The first image shows a numerical Schlieren visualisation of a hypersonic double cone at Mach 12, highlighting shock wave–boundary layer interactions. The second image shows a surface static pressure distribution graph compared against experimental data.

Reflecting on his time at UC, Morgan shared:
“Studying at UC has pushed me to grow both technically and personally. I’ve really valued the guidance from my supervisors and the chance to work on research that connects to real aerospace challenges in Aotearoa.”

Morgan is now working as a Graduate Mechanical Engineer at Holmes Solutions, focusing on the testing, design, and simulation of roadside safety barriers and mooring line snapback protection systems.
